Overview

Stonehelm is the only home Seraphina has ever known. Working as a seer in her humble village, she spends her days reassuring people about their future and her nights reading about the legendary civilisation that inhabited this land before them — the mighty Ascendians. Unlike her friend, Ana, she does not dream of travelling. She is too anxious for adventure, too obsessed with her research to explore the real world, and too proud to admit how much she wishes she had her friend’s courage. Until an unexpected vision makes her question everything she thought she knew about her world. If dragons disappeared nine hundred years ago, as they were supposed to, how could her vision ever come true? The answer comes in the form of a suspicious client, a lying goblin who tricks her into opening a secret portal and allowing hordes of goblins to march through and plunder their way to Stonehelm… Attracted by Seraphina’s newfound powers, three dragons, Frostbite, Ember, and Stormrider, sneak through the portal to find her and put an end to the goblins’ undying thirst for power. In order to stop the goblins, humans and dragons must form an unprecedented alliance and win a battle that has been secretly raging for centuries. The key to their success? Seraphina herself…

Author Information

Charles Birkett is a writer, with cerebral palsy and epilepsy, and an advocate for the knowledge that we humans can do anything we put our minds to doing. He travelled all over the UK and other countries, and enjoys cycling and walking ,but his main interest is in gaming. He draws his main inspiration from the games he plays, and all the experiences life throws at him.
